They are all pretty simple, but c64 has composite right out of the box. OD2 iirc requires an amp summer schematic to get composite. 2600 is the same way. They are very simple circuits, but still a little more effort than c64.
It's also suggested to modify the audio since it comes out pretty hot with a voltage offset.
